Nature and Culture Plush David Scott portrays the cityNewly available in paperback, this book takes the University of Manchesters Museum as its subject. By setting the museum in its cultural and intellectual contexts, Nature and culture explores twentieth century collecting and display, and the status of the object in the modern world. Beginning with the origins of the Manchester Museum, accounting for its development as an internationally renowned university museum, and concluding at its major expansion
